Visitor Visa Requirements

Short-stay tourist visa rules between Azerbaijan and Burundi. To live, work, or study long-term in Burundi, you'll need a separate residence or work visa — check Burundi's immigration authority.

Azerbaijan passport

Azerbaijan passport holder visiting Burundi

Visa on Arrival
Azerbaijan passport holders can obtain a visa on arrival in Burundi.
Burundi passport

Burundi passport holder visiting Azerbaijan

Visa Online (e-Visa)
Burundi passport holders need to apply for an e-Visa before travelling to Azerbaijan.

Data: Henley Passport Index. Check with the destination country's embassy for the most current requirements.

What's the weather like in Burundi compared to Azerbaijan?

The average high temperature in Bujumbura is 85°F, compared to 65°F in Baku. Bujumbura receives around 30.9 in of rainfall per year, while Baku gets 8.3 in.

What language do they speak in Burundi?

The official languages in Burundi are French and Kirundi. In Azerbaijan, the official language is Azerbaijani.
